    1. Optimize Your Profile

    Your LinkedIn profile is the foundation of your online presence, so it’s essential to make it as compelling as possible. Start by optimizing your profile with a professional photo, headline, and summary that highlights your skills and experience. Use keywords related to your industry to make it easier for others to find you on the platform.

    Next, fill out your experience section with relevant job titles, descriptions, and accomplishments. Don’t forget to add your education, skills, and any relevant certifications or awards. Finally, make sure your profile is complete and up-to-date, so it’s easy for others to get in touch with you.

    2. Connect with People You Know

    The first step in growing your LinkedIn network is to connect with people you already know. This includes your colleagues, classmates, friends, and family members. You can also import your email contacts to find people you’ve worked with in the past.

    When sending connection requests, personalize your message and explain why you want to connect. Be polite, professional, and avoid using generic messages. This will increase the chances of your request being accepted.

    3. Join LinkedIn Groups

    LinkedIn Groups are a great way to find and connect with like-minded professionals in your industry. Search for groups related to your niche and join them to start networking.

    Once you’ve joined a group, introduce yourself and participate in discussions. Share your expertise, ask questions, and engage with other members. This will help you build relationships and establish yourself as a thought leader in your industry.

    2. Can I buy LinkedIn connections?

    No, buying LinkedIn connections is not a recommended strategy. It is against LinkedIn’s terms of service, and purchased connections are often low-quality and not relevant to your industry or interests. It is better to focus on building organic connections through networking, sharing valuable content, and engaging with your connections.

    Additionally, having a large number of connections does not necessarily mean that you have a strong network. It is more important to have quality connections who are relevant to your industry and can provide value to your career or business.
